We use VLANs for client Internet access and would like to monitor bandwidth usage. Thus far, I have been having a real issue getting that setup. Is this even possible? If so, please point me in the right direction. Thanks!

from PRTG's side, the sensor just processes the incoming flows. If you can get a switch or some software get to do it for a VLAN, PRTG can be used. As alternative, you might want to have a look at the packet sniffer sensor. That one can be a bit more difficult to setup, as the sensor works only on NICs present on the probe the sensor is running on.
